2017-11-29 2 views
0

Ich arbeite an einer Excel-Tabelle. Ich habe ein Dropdown mit Werten. Ich muss dort einen Wert hinzufügen.Fehlende DataValidation DataSource

Es gibt kein Makro und es gibt keine Verbindung. Das einzige, was ich fand, war:

  1. ich die Zelle zur Hand ausgewählt
  2. Daten -> Datenvalidierung
  3. In der Quelle i diese Zeichenfolge sehen = Variablen $ D $ 1:! $ D $ 23

Ich habe kein Blatt namens Variablen oder etwas in der Nähe der Wortvariablen in einem der Blätter. Woher kommt das?

Es gibt auch Schutz für die Arbeitsmappe, aber nicht für die einzelnen Blätter. Könnte das das Problem sein?

Danke

+0

Haben Sie überprüft, ob ein Blatt namens "Variablen" versteckt ist? Wenn dort nichts ist, öffnen Sie den VBA-Editor und sehen Sie, ob dort ein Modul für ein "Variablen" -Blatt vorhanden ist, da Sie Blätter in einen "Sehr Versteckt" -Zustand setzen können, der auch nicht in der Excel-Benutzeroberfläche angezeigt wird. – Wedge

+0

Ja, wenn ich versuche, die Makros zu öffnen, kann ich 3-4 andere Blätter sehen, die nicht angezeigt werden. Die Arbeitsmappe ist geschützt. Ich habe versucht, eines dieser Makros auszuführen, die Ihnen ein benutzbares Passwort zeigen sollen, aber es hat nicht funktioniert. Habe sogar versucht, die Dateierweiterung in xls (ältere Excel-Versionen) umzubenennen, aber es reagiert nicht mehr. Ich warte ungefähr 20 Minuten, keine Fortschritte und schließe es. – Artexias

Antwort

0

Sie in der Regel den Inhalt einer versteckten Blatt ganz einfach mit dem Direkt-Fenster überprüfen.

So öffnen Sie den VBA-Editor (Alt-F11), gehen Sie zu dem Direkt-Fenster (Ctrl-G) und versuchen:

?Variables.[D17] 

Wenn dies funktioniert, können Sie dies wiederholen Sie die anderen 22 Validierung zu sehen Werte (oder schreiben Sie ein kleines Sub, mit Debug.Print anstatt ?).